Description
For the Love of Therapy provides insight from Licensed Therapist as well as Associate Therapist and Psychiatrist on various Mental Health Disorders. This podcast will aim to provide detail description, education, and resources for various individuals and will provide how these disorders affect relationships.

On today's episode of For the Love of Therapy, I had the privilege of speaking with Lan Nguyen, A licensed Clinical Social Worker who provides virtual therapy in the states of Texas and California. Lan provides therapy for AAPI and BIPOC milennial adults who feel stuck in life. Lan helps people break the cycle of trauma so that these adults can feel more confident using their voice and live authentically. On today’s episode, we discussed Intergenerational trauma, the effects of intergenerational trauma, what this trauma looks like and how to break the cycle.
